WebOn December 22, 2024, the federal Tax Cuts and Jobs Act of 2024 (Act) [1] was enacted and made many changes to federal law. Specifically, to IRC Section 708. The Act repealed the IRC Section 708 (b) (1) (B) rule providing for technical terminations of partnerships (for federal purposes). What does this mean for California taxpayers?
WebJan 22, 2024 · Under IRC § 708(a), a partnership is considered as a continuing entity for income tax purposes unless it is terminated. Given the proliferation of state law entities taxed as partnerships today (e.g., limited liability companies and limited liability partnerships), a good understanding of the rules surrounding termination is ever important.

RULING songs with three letter titlesWebThe AB partnership terminates under section 708 (b) (1) (A) when B purchases A's entire interest in AB. Accordingly, A must treat the transaction as the sale of a partnership interest. Reg. section 1.741-1 (b).
